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Wrabness

While Wrabness Station doesn't have the frills of a ticket office or machines, it does cater to the essentials for a comfortable journey. The station features a helpful information point staffed by friendly personnel to assist with travel details. For those requiring it, an induction loop is available, ensuring that travelers with hearing impairments can navigate their journey effortlessly.

Accessibility features at Wrabness are commendable, with step-free access available to both platforms. However, please note that access to Platform 2, serving trains towards Harwich Town, involves a steep ramp that may not suit all passengers. Additionally, there are no restroom facilities or waiting rooms at the station, but seating is available for those waiting for their train.

Parking is well-catered for with 26 spaces, including two accessible spots, operated by National Car Parks Ltd. The charges are reasonable, with daily parking at £3.00 and annual options available for £340.00.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Millbrook (Hants) station is quite modest in terms of facilities. There's no traditional ticket office or ticket machines available, which means the purchase and collection of tickets must be done in advance online, or you can utilize the Permit to Travel machine. This machine requires you to exchange your purchased permit for a ticket on the train itself. An induction loop is available, and while there is no waiting room, seating area, or first-class lounge, the station does offer customer help points for inquiries. Although staff help at the station isn't provided, you can reach out to the Customer Service Centre at 0345 6000 650.

Accessibility and Support

Accessibility at Millbrook (Hants) may present a challenge for those requiring step-free access, as the station is categorized as having no such facility. However, there are ramps for train access, and assistance can be arranged with the train guards for boarding and alighting. It is advisable to book assistance up to two hours before your journey when traveling with South Western Railway, although impromptu requests can be managed on-site. While there are no accessible toilets or waiting areas, you can make use of the public Wi-Fi to stay connected during your wait.

Getting Around

Transport links to and from the station are straightforward. A rail replacement service is available, with buses stopping outside the station on the slip road from Waterloo Road to Mountbatten Way (A33) for travel to Totton/Romsey, or on Mountbatten Way by Lakelands Drive for journeys heading towards Southampton. For planning ahead, downloadable bus route information is available from National Rail.
